With a Delta E of 20.9, these colors are very different. RAL 210-3 belongs to the Yellow family while RAL 160-M belongs to the Purple family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 210-3 is brighter with an LRV of 76.0 compared to 38.0 for RAL 160-M. Both colors have similar saturation levels.
